Benign prostatic hyperplasia

Swelling of the prostate due to hyperplasia of glandular epithelium, stroma, and smooth muscle.

Also known as: Benign prostatic hypertrophy, BPH

Symptoms & findings

Symptoms

Hematuria, Incomplete voiding, Nocturia, Polyuria, Postvoid dribbling, Urinary incontinence, Urinary urgency, Weak urine stream

Clinical findings

Elevated Creatinine, Elevated PSA, Urinary retention

Approach

Treatment

  1. Mild symptoms --> Watchful waiting: PSA, size evaluation, biopsy

  2. Moderate symptoms --> Medication: [qy4]

    • Alpha blockers --> relax prostate/bladder-muscles --> reduce symptoms

    • 5-alpha-reductase inhibitor --> decrease testosterone --> slow the prostate growth

    • Phosphodiesterase-5 Enzyme Inhibitor --> smooth muscle relaxation

    • Anticholinergic (risk for urinary retention)

  3. Severe symptoms --> Surgery: [qy4]

    • Prostatic urethral lift

    • Transurethral resection of the prostate (TURP)

    • Transurethral incision of the prostate (TUIP)

    • Transurethral electrovaporization of the prostate (electrode)

    • Transurethral photovaporization of the prostate (laser)

    • Transurethral aquablation of the prostate (high-pressure water-jet)

    • Open prostatectomy

    • Prostatic arterial embolization

Differential diagnoses

Bladder cancer, Prostate cancer, Prostatitis, Renal cell carcinoma, Urinary tract infection, Urolithiasis
